Q: My plugin failed the Tintlock contrast audit — what now?

A: Plugins that fail the color-contrast check are quarantined until resubmission. Fix the flagged components, rerun the audit locally with the Tintlock CLI, and resubmit through the Perchway portal. If your publisher account was locked during quarantine, restore it using the recovery passphrase below.

unlock words, fadug-tageg: zorix-wenwyn-quenmir

## v2.8.0 — Queue-depth autoscaler

Added an autoscaler for the Fennelworks job runners that scales on queue depth rather than CPU. It samples the Brimside queue every 30 seconds, scales up when depth exceeds 200 for two consecutive samples, and scales down only after ten quiet minutes to avoid flapping. Limits are set in autoscaler.toml; change them cautiously, as the downstream database has fixed connection capacity. Questions about the scaling policy should be directed to the maintainer named below.

account owner for bawip-tahag: Raleth Quenok

Heads up for on-call: the Thistledown timetable solver keeps timing out on the nightly CI run. Looks like the new room-constraint pass balloons memory when a school has more than 60 classrooms — the Marrowgate fixture triggers it every time. Quick fix is bumping the runner to the large tier. If you need to escalate, reference the trace token below.

pipeline stamp: htk31_f769b577b3028a4e9958e5bb8d1259a